description Product Description

Used as a chiral building block in asymmetric synthesis, particularly in the pharmaceutical industry for developing enantiomerically pure drugs. Its bulky mesityl group enhances stereoselectivity in reactions such as catalytic hydrogenation and nucleophilic additions. Commonly employed in the preparation of chiral ligands and organocatalysts, enabling efficient synthesis of complex molecules with high optical purity. Also utilized in resolution processes to separate enantiomers due to its well-defined stereochemistry and crystalline properties.
